**Q: How does the Glintway metrics sidecar aggregate counters?**

The sidecar runs alongside each service pod and scrapes local endpoints every 15 seconds, buffering up to five minutes of samples before flushing to the Perchline gateway. As a contractor, note that you should never modify the flush interval directly; changes must go through the Telemetry Guild's review queue. If a pod restarts, buffered samples are lost by design. For access requests or schema questions, reach the Telemetry Guild at the address below.

escalation mailbox, fafof-bahip: tamael@ordincorp.test

**Ticket: tailgrep auth expired again**

Hey on-call — `tailgrep` (our log-tailing CLI) started throwing 401s around midnight, so the old key for the Streamhollow ingest API has definitely lapsed. Anyone running `tailgrep follow` will hit the same wall. I already minted a replacement with the usual read-only scope; just drop it into your local config. Here's the new key for Streamhollow.

API key for yahig-tadup: kto7_ubizbYm

Q3 Planning Note — Western Region Sales Review

Branch managers: Q3 figures for the Ostwick corridor are in. Revenue up 4%, margins flat. Tarnfield and Bryle underperformed; corrective targets attached. Review meetings run the second week of the quarter — come prepared with pipeline data. Staffing requests due Friday. Strategic direction for next year is set out in the confidential note below.

management briefing: Silethax Systems plans to raise the Holix list price by 50.2 percent in December. The steering committee signed off on a budget of $329.9 million for Project Holok. The renewal with Juldorax Foods closes at $278.2 million a year, 54.3 percent above the last contract. Project Briir slips by one quarter because of the supplier delay.

## PR: tighten docslint thresholds for the Fernwright handbook

This adds the `docslint` pass to CI for all handbook pages. It flags stale anchors, heading-depth jumps, and lines over the wrap limit, failing the build only above a configurable error budget. Future maintainers: thresholds live in one place so you never grep for magic numbers. Warnings stay advisory for the first two release cycles. The enforced limits are as follows.

limits module of tafop-hahop:
WEIGHTS = {
    "julmir": 223,
    "belox": 987,
    "lamion": 470,
    "pelath": 609,
    "fraok": 1010,
    "eliion": 343,
    "drudor": 342,
}